## Authentication

The Pylontide telemetry agent compresses payloads with zstd before upload to the Corvane ingest tier. Compression is mandatory; uncompressed batches are rejected at the gateway. Each request must carry a valid key in the `X-Pylontide-Auth` header. For local development against the staging ingest service, use the key below.

gateway credential: kto3_qfe

Board summary. Decision: Voltaire Goods marketing spend cut 18% effective next quarter. Rationale: soft demand in the Carmine region, duplicated agency retainers, underperforming broadcast buys. Protected lines: the Lumen launch, retail co-op funds. Agency consolidation moves from three partners to one. Headcount unaffected; two open roles frozen. Savings redirect to margin recovery, not reinvestment, this cycle. Expect pushback from the regional teams; hold the line. The fuller strategic picture is captured in the note directly below.

confidential, kagep-kahof: Druokax Systems plans to lower the Ulaath list price by 53 percent in March.

Handover: Larkspur firmware channel. I moved the beta ring cadence to weekly and capped rollout at 10% per day after last month's bricking scare. Rollback images stay pinned for two releases. Watch the staged-rollout dashboard Monday mornings before widening. The channel settings I left in place are as follows.

deployment values, kajep-kageg:
[praix]
host = praix.paliqcorp.corp
user = praix_svc
database = praix_prod

Careful review of the Wrenfield autocomplete widget: the debounce logic looks correct, but cancellation of in-flight lookups happens after state update, which can flash stale suggestions for Brackmoor-region addresses. Please swap the order and add a test for rapid keystrokes. Also, these hardcoded numbers should move into the shared config. The current values are shown below.

tuning constants:
QUOTAS = {
    "druwyn": 5,
    "holix": 5,
    "zorath": 5,
    "holwyn": 10,
}